Review: What is Energy?
•Anything that can cause a change in matter.
![Page 28: Energy unit 2016](https://reader036.vdocuments.site/reader036/viewer/2022062902/58eff7bc1a28ab78788b45a3/html5/thumbnails/28.jpg)
Two Types of Energy:
1) Kinetic Energy2) Potential Energy
![Page 29: Energy unit 2016](https://reader036.vdocuments.site/reader036/viewer/2022062902/58eff7bc1a28ab78788b45a3/html5/thumbnails/29.jpg)
Potential Energy1. Potential Energy is stored energy.2. An object with potential energy has the ability to move or change.
![Page 30: Energy unit 2016](https://reader036.vdocuments.site/reader036/viewer/2022062902/58eff7bc1a28ab78788b45a3/html5/thumbnails/30.jpg)
Potential Energy3. Potential energy depends on an object’s position or condition.Example:
![Page 31: Energy unit 2016](https://reader036.vdocuments.site/reader036/viewer/2022062902/58eff7bc1a28ab78788b45a3/html5/thumbnails/31.jpg)
Examples:
![Page 32: Energy unit 2016](https://reader036.vdocuments.site/reader036/viewer/2022062902/58eff7bc1a28ab78788b45a3/html5/thumbnails/32.jpg)
Kinetic Energy4. Kinetic Energy is the energy of movement.5. It depends on the mass and speed of a moving object.

Forms of Energy
All pictures are from Microsoft office 365.
![Page 89: Energy unit 2016](https://reader036.vdocuments.site/reader036/viewer/2022062902/58eff7bc1a28ab78788b45a3/html5/thumbnails/89.jpg)
Forms of Energy *Thermal/Heat• *Chemical• * Mechanical
ElectricalSoundLight
Energy can be transferred, or
converted, from one form to
another!
![Page 90: Energy unit 2016](https://reader036.vdocuments.site/reader036/viewer/2022062902/58eff7bc1a28ab78788b45a3/html5/thumbnails/90.jpg)
Mechanical Energy• Energy associated with the motion of an object.
ChewingSoundFrog Dancing
![Page 91: Energy unit 2016](https://reader036.vdocuments.site/reader036/viewer/2022062902/58eff7bc1a28ab78788b45a3/html5/thumbnails/91.jpg)
Sound Energy• Produced by vibrations.
RadioThunderVoices
![Page 92: Energy unit 2016](https://reader036.vdocuments.site/reader036/viewer/2022062902/58eff7bc1a28ab78788b45a3/html5/thumbnails/92.jpg)
Electrical Energy
• Moving electrical charges that produce electricity and energy.
Static ShockPower PlantBattery
![Page 93: Energy unit 2016](https://reader036.vdocuments.site/reader036/viewer/2022062902/58eff7bc1a28ab78788b45a3/html5/thumbnails/93.jpg)
Chemical Energy• Potential energy stored in
chemical bonds.
FoodFire Cracker
tree gasoline
![Page 94: Energy unit 2016](https://reader036.vdocuments.site/reader036/viewer/2022062902/58eff7bc1a28ab78788b45a3/html5/thumbnails/94.jpg)
Thermal/Heat Energy• Total energy of the particles in a
substance or material.All objects give off
thermal energyIce cream melting
gains thermal energy
Rubbing hands together
![Page 95: Energy unit 2016](https://reader036.vdocuments.site/reader036/viewer/2022062902/58eff7bc1a28ab78788b45a3/html5/thumbnails/95.jpg)
Light Energy• Energy that travels in waves and
can move through empty space.
SunStarsLight Bulb

Thermal Energy Transfer
• Thermal energy transfer is heat moving from a warmer object to a cooler object.
![Page 118: Energy unit 2016](https://reader036.vdocuments.site/reader036/viewer/2022062902/58eff7bc1a28ab78788b45a3/html5/thumbnails/118.jpg)
Heat TransferConduction, Convection and Radiation
![Page 119: Energy unit 2016](https://reader036.vdocuments.site/reader036/viewer/2022062902/58eff7bc1a28ab78788b45a3/html5/thumbnails/119.jpg)
How is Heat Transferred?There are THREE ways heat can move.
– Conduction
– Convection
– Radiation
![Page 120: Energy unit 2016](https://reader036.vdocuments.site/reader036/viewer/2022062902/58eff7bc1a28ab78788b45a3/html5/thumbnails/120.jpg)
CONDUCTION• Heat is transferred from one particle of matter to
another in an object without the movement of the object.
• Conduction = CONTACT• (Requires direct contact between two
surfaces.)
![Page 121: Energy unit 2016](https://reader036.vdocuments.site/reader036/viewer/2022062902/58eff7bc1a28ab78788b45a3/html5/thumbnails/121.jpg)
Have you ever…• Touched a metal spoon sitting in a pan of
boiling water only to be surprised by HOW hot it is??
Think back to what you know about metals and nonmetals. What conducts heat better, metal or nonmetal? Why?
![Page 122: Energy unit 2016](https://reader036.vdocuments.site/reader036/viewer/2022062902/58eff7bc1a28ab78788b45a3/html5/thumbnails/122.jpg)
Example of Conduction – pot handle on stove
• Think of a metal spoon in a pot of water being heated.
• The fast-moving particles of the fire collide with the slow-moving particles of the cool pot.
• Because of these collisions, the slower particles move faster and heat is transferred.
• Then the particles of the pot collide with the particles in the water, which collide with the particles at one end of the spoon.
• As the particles move faster, the metal spoon gets hotter. This process of conduction is repeated all along the metal until the entire spoon is hot.
![Page 123: Energy unit 2016](https://reader036.vdocuments.site/reader036/viewer/2022062902/58eff7bc1a28ab78788b45a3/html5/thumbnails/123.jpg)
EXAMPLE OF CONDUCTION
• A piece of cheese melts as heat is transferred from the meat to the cheese (Contact)
![Page 124: Energy unit 2016](https://reader036.vdocuments.site/reader036/viewer/2022062902/58eff7bc1a28ab78788b45a3/html5/thumbnails/124.jpg)
CONVECTION• Convection is the movement that transfers heat
within fluids and air (gas)• Heat is transferred by currents within the fluid or gas
• Convection = VENTS (through air and liquid particles)
• Convection moves in a circular pattern
![Page 125: Energy unit 2016](https://reader036.vdocuments.site/reader036/viewer/2022062902/58eff7bc1a28ab78788b45a3/html5/thumbnails/125.jpg)
Examples of Convection:• Have you ever noticed that the air near the
ceiling is warmer than the air near the floor? Or that water in a pool is cooler at the deep end?
• Examples: air movement in a home, pot of heating water.
• Pick one of these examples and draw the circular pattern in your notes.
![Page 126: Energy unit 2016](https://reader036.vdocuments.site/reader036/viewer/2022062902/58eff7bc1a28ab78788b45a3/html5/thumbnails/126.jpg)
Explaining Convection
• Convection currents cause the cooler breezes you experience by a large body of water.
• These currents also cause the movement of magma within the earth.
![Page 127: Energy unit 2016](https://reader036.vdocuments.site/reader036/viewer/2022062902/58eff7bc1a28ab78788b45a3/html5/thumbnails/127.jpg)
RADIATION• Radiation is the transfer of energy by
electromagnetic waves• Radiation does NOT require matter to transfer
thermal energy• Radiation = Radiates (heat escaping the sun)
![Page 128: Energy unit 2016](https://reader036.vdocuments.site/reader036/viewer/2022062902/58eff7bc1a28ab78788b45a3/html5/thumbnails/128.jpg)
Radiation May Come From Other Sources
Have you ever sat too close to a campfire while cooking marshmallows? You’re enjoying the warmth ….. only to notice that your skin is really warm?
![Page 129: Energy unit 2016](https://reader036.vdocuments.site/reader036/viewer/2022062902/58eff7bc1a28ab78788b45a3/html5/thumbnails/129.jpg)
Examples of RADIATION
1. Fire2. Heat Lamps3. Sun
